Excerpt from A Guide to New Brunswick, British North America, &C Almost all the moral and industrious emi grants to this Province, whatever have been their occupations, have succeeded in securing to themselves a competency, and many have oh tained wealth. The lower class of labourers, when they have devoted themselves to steady habits and industry, have been successful; (of this I have been an eye-witness, when I visited the several settlements which was under my ministerial charge - the district over which I had to ride every month being upwards of 160 miles, ) and where there are instances to the contrary, they may generally be attributed to idleness and intemperance. The inquiry made by persons in the Mother Country, who are desirous to settle in New Brunswick, is, what employment will they find there? And when they are informed that the principal occupation of the inhabitants is lumbering in the dense forests, amidst the deep snows of winter, they have no desire to venture upon a pursuit with which they are altogether unacquainted. "When the American revolutionary war ended, what was to become New Brunswick was almost the last wilderness on the Atlantic seaboard. Into this hinterland flowed thousands of Loyalists whom the war had transformed from the settled and prosperous into the uprooted and dispossessed. The experience made of them a people who, as a condition of survival, had to become cautious and severely practical – and sturdier than ever. The development of the province they made is an absorbing history."--Page 4 of cover.
